  • USACE Awards Bid, Beach Replenishment Project Moves Closer to Completion
    Posted in Press Release on September 27, 2013 | Preview rr

    The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ers this morning announced it has awarded the fourth and final contract to replenish Sandy-ravaged beaches from Sea Bright to the Manasquan Inlet in Monmouth County, U.S. Rep. Chris Smith (NJ-04) said Friday. For the beaches between Asbury Park and Avon-by-the-Sea, this phase of the “Sea Bright to Manasquan Beach Erosion Control Project” was awarded to the Great Lakes Dredge & Dock Company LLC, of Oak Brook, Ill., in the amount of $18,332,500.     There is a non-lethal way to help ensure that Bashar al-Assad and other perpetrators of atrocities in Syria are held to account, not someday far in the future but beginning now. The U.N. Security Council must move immediately to establish a Syrian war crimes tribunal. Past ad hoc war crimes tribunals — including courts for Sierra Leone, Rwanda and the former Yugoslavia — have made a difference, but they sent thugs to jail after hostilities ended.
